Whether you’re a vintage car enthusiast or just looking for a unique ride, the Nissan Figaro is sure to catch your eye This compact, retro-styled car was originally produced in 1991 as a limited edition release, making it a sought-after vehicle for collectors and fans alike But with its rarity comes a price tag that may leave some potential buyers wondering: how much does a Nissan Figaro cost?
The cost of a Nissan Figaro can vary depending on a number of factors, including the condition of the car, its mileage, and any modifications or additions that have been made On average, you can expect to pay anywhere from $10,000 to $20,000 for a Nissan Figaro in decent condition However, prices can go as high as $30,000 or more for a fully restored model with low mileage.
One of the most important factors that can impact the cost of a Nissan Figaro is its condition If you’re looking to save money, you may be able to find a Figaro that is in need of some repairs or restoration work While this can be a more affordable option upfront, be prepared to invest both time and money into bringing the car back to its former glory.
On the other hand, if you’re willing to pay top dollar for a pristine Nissan Figaro, you can expect to find models that have been fully restored and meticulously maintained These cars may come with a higher price tag, but they are sure to turn heads wherever you go.
Another factor to consider when determining the cost of a Nissan Figaro is its mileage Like any other vehicle, the more miles a Figaro has on it, the lower its value may be If you’re looking for a bargain, you may be able to find a higher mileage Figaro at a lower price However, be sure to have the car thoroughly inspected before making a purchase to avoid any surprises down the road.
